Output ecdb3103951066dedaff4dafd7c1f0f631bb84660cae4192b857f22d9c531c54:4

value
17617627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79709a80382a32275544d0f413dffd84eb223dd7 OP_EQUAL
address
MJyGtUHoQ3uDogfYi48d1XDNs4JYgSWLgC
transaction
ecdb3103951066dedaff4dafd7c1f0f631bb84660cae4192b857f22d9c531c54
spent
true